Laurel 01:21 PM 09-26-2013
NOT this one. I have it. http://www.diapers.com/p/little-tike...y-center-39935



It was adorable so I bought it. I thought the attached laundry center was so cute. I'm not sure why it has such a high rating on this site. I bought it directly from the Little Tikes site though.

The door from the dryer comes off so easily and is hard to pop back on. I now leave it off. The dishwasher and oven open in the direction that real ones do so little ones can't help themselves and step on them when they're down. The dishwasher one has broken already so we only have a shelf there now. It is only a matter of time before the stove does the same thing. Oh and the refrigerator door is really hard to open. They have to yank on it.

I usually like Little Tikes products but was very disappointed with this.

Laurel

Edited to add: I didn't see it just now on the Little Tikes site and this site says vendor discontinued it. I guess I wasn't the only one who didn't like it! BUT if you see a used one, don't buy it. You'll be sorry.

Unregistered 10:20 AM 09-27-2013
I re purposed an old $2 yard sale IKEA side table.( I'm just to darn cheap to shell out the bucks for a kitchen! ) It's a good size/height for the kids and it's on wheels which is handy. I painted it white, painted 4 burners on it and attached real stove knobs (salvaged from an old stove). I screwed 2 inch screws halfway through each sides, in a row of 4 to hang things on.
All the dishes and such are real kitchen items, thrift store finds and some wicker baskets of wood food. Total cost was under $20!
It's worked out so well, it's simple, easy to wipe down and I can keep it in the playroom or wheel it into the kitchen.
